As global populations grow, climate change intensifies, and urbanization accelerates, securing a resilient freshwater supply and achieving sustainable water use across industry and agriculture remain top global priorities. Tapping into saline waters and wastewater is one of most viable paths forward. While traditional membrane processes—such as microfiltration, ultrafiltration, nanofiltration, and reverse osmosis—continue to serve as the industry gold standard, addressing the clean water deficit requires exploring the entire spectrum of separation science. This includes advancing our understanding of transport mechanisms and driving the development of emerging desalination technologies.

Continuous breakthrough is vital to reduce energy consumption, minimize carbon footprints, and ensure the robust removal of emerging contaminants. The 8th International Conference on Desalination Science and Technology 2027 (DESAL 2027) will serve as a dynamic forum bridging laboratory-scale discoveries with industry-scale desalination applications. The program will place a strong emphasis on novel desalination materials, innovative hybrid systems, and advanced module design, alongside critical operational strategies encompassing pre-treatment and post-treatment processes, as well as membrane fouling and control. Beyond engineering efficiency, environmental stewardship and circular economy principles are critical to the future of sustainable desalination. Transitioning from waste management to asset creation, a key focus of this edition will be brine/concentrate management and resource recovery.

Topics include:

  • Novel desalination materials

  • Nanofiltration, reverse osmosis, forward osmosis, pressure retarded osmosis

  • Transport mechanisms in desalination

  • Electrochemical systems

  • Emerging desalination technologies

  • Ultrafiltration, microfiltration

  • Membrane distillation, pervaporation

  • Membrane fouling and control

  • Pre-treatment and post-treatment processes

  • Resources recovery

  • Novel hybrid systems and module design

  • Industry-scale desalination

  • Green hydrogen production from desalinated water

  • AI, digital twins and autonomous operation for desalination systems

  • Renewable energy integration and low-carbon desalination

  • Environmental impact, brine management, LCA and sustainability assessment

  • Desalination economics, policy, planning and community engagement
